Full Job Description

Specialist training and support will be provided where necessary with the the chosen candidates required to develop into a skilled maintenance technician who may be required to:

  • Maintain, test and repair some/all of the numerous mechanical equipment on site such as pumps, steam systems, etc.
  • Verify and maintain prescribed high standards linked to operating theatre ventilation systems,
  • Undertake mechanical maintenance tasks as part of a robust Legionella management programme
  • Inspect, maintain and support the various piped medical gas systems on site.
  • Specialist Training will be provided to successful applicants before being appointing as a CP (Competent Person)., To install, maintain, service and repair the full range of estates specialist equipment, plant and infrastructure.
  • Provides technical advice to other estates maintenance staff and contractors to ensure compliance with safety standards and procedures.
  • Act in the role of Competent Person/Responsible Person, as defined by Health Technical Memorandum, for at least two of the following areas:o Water Safetyo Lifting Equipmento Pressure Systemso Medical Gasses.o Specialist Ventilationo Decontamination.o Confined Spaces
  • Undertakes condition surveys, evaluates inspection reports., Qualification and experience mechanical / motor con BTEC or City and Guilds in a complex engineering field and BTEC or City & Guilds in Specialist Equipment maintenance

    Candidates must have completed a recognised mechanical engineering or plumbing apprenticeship, be self-motivated with a desire to develop new skills and flexible to meet the demands of a large acute hospital., BTEC, HNC/HND or Approved Apprenticeship, City and Guilds or NVQ 3 Technicians Certificate or equivalent qualifications in relevant topics plus significant technical experience
  • Comprehensive post apprenticeship experience, Expertise and a full understanding of complex mechanical healthcare related infrastructure.
  • Thorough working knowledge of Building Management Systems.
  • Have a detailed working knowledge of the following: Ventilation and cooling systems. Steam generation and distribution. MTHW & LTHW generation and distribution. DHW & DCW generation and distribution. BMS control systems. Pneumatic systems.
  • An understanding of key legislation relating to the maintenance of facilities.
  • Experience of working in an industrial environment.
  • Electrical/mechanical services systems maintenance, Mechanical testing and inspection
  • Knowledge of Healthcare Technical Guidance.
  • Hospital experience
  • Working with steam systems, Able to make workload assessments and allocation
  • Ability to evaluate and solve problems in situ
  • Ability to communicate verbally by phone and in writing to Senior Management and clinical users throughout the Trust.
  • PC and IT literate. Ability to use tools and test equipment
  • Fit and mobile
